MER helps sponsor the 2009 Charleston Duck-Race
As part of MER's commitment to supporting local charities and fund-raisers, MER is a 2009 sponsor of the Daniel's Island Rotary Club '2009 Charleston Duck Race.' MER donated floating containment boom & labor to help organize the raceway's and contain the duck-race.
Proceeds from the fund-raiser went to the Down Syndrome Association of the Lowcountry, East Cooper Community Outreach, East Cooper Meals-on-Wheels, Friends of Berkeley County Library, Junior Achievement of Coastal South Carolina.

New Orleans Oil Spill Response
MER management personnel were on-scene to assess the situation the day of the release. On Friday, July 25th, Moran Environmental Recovery (MER) was authorized to dispatch resources to assist in the clean-up effort. Resources include personnel, various types of work boats, oil skimmers, pressure washers, and absorbent materials. All were dispatched in a collective effort from each of MER's East Coast resource centers.
